2015-10-04 1032 views
1

我想安裝的插件(Eclipse Jubula數據庫驅動程序)僅在Eclipse Marketplace中可用。但是,我需要將它安裝到未連接到Internet的計算機上運行的Eclipse軟件包。有什麼方法可以獲取更新站點地址,以便我可以下載文件以進行脫機安裝?這answer解決了下載更新站點的問題,但我沒有看到從eclipse marketplace獲取更新站點地址的方法。從Eclipse Marketplace下載Eclipse插件以供離線使用

回答

0

在Eclipse Marketplace的每個插件頁面上,使用「安裝」按鈕下方的最右側圖標。這將打開一個包含更新站點URL的覆蓋圖。

1

是的。花了幾個星期後,我發現這個簡單的過程:

  1. 解壓Eclipse在文件夾A
  2. 解壓Eclipse在文件夾B
  3. 啓動Eclipse文件夾A
  4. 安裝插件
  5. 刪除文件夾plugins/中兩個Eclipse安裝中相同的所有文件。
  6. 刪除文件夾features/中的所有文件,這兩個文件在Eclipse安裝中都是相同的。

讓您留下運行插件所需的文件。但由於這不再是更新站點,因此無法輕鬆安裝插件。

爲了解決這個問題,你有兩個選擇:

  1. 把文件放到dropins/ folder

  2. 創建使用您確定文件的更新站點。祝你好運。我試了好幾個月,但結果最好不穩定(「組件無法安裝,因爲...」)。

1

剛剛從plugins/跟進阿龍的回答,相關文件和features/進入一個新的文件夾eclipse/然後可以放入dropins/文件夾。

因此,對於一個具體的例子,我想將Jenerate plugin安裝到離線機器上。當時我嘗試了這個,更新站點是離線的。所以我繼續通過市場在另一臺可以上網的機器上安裝它,導致創建一個文件夾features/org.jenerate.feature_1.0.2以及一個罐子plugins/org.jenerate_1.0.2.jar。我將這些分別放入離線機器上新創建的目錄中,分別爲dropins/jenerate/eclipse/featuresdropins/jenerate/eclipse/plugins。另請參閱此Eclipse help document